Scott Remains First In Newest Class AA Football Rankings

The Scott Skyhawks maintained the top spot in this week’s WVSSAC Class AA Football Rankings, released on Tuesday to lead all area teams.

Scott (7-0) is coming off a bye week and now faces the Poca Dots (1-6). The opening kick is set for Friday at 7:30 pm.

Logan (6-2) is ranked 11th this week after beating Liberty-Raleigh, 36-14. The Wildcats have a huge game this week when it travels to county rival Chapmanville.

The Tigers (4-3) got a last-second 26-21 win over Wayne last weekend and finds themselves in 16th. Chapmanville and Logan will kick off at 7pm.

Mingo Central (3-4) is ranked 22nd this week after picking up a 52-28 win over Shady Spring. The Miners will travel to 13th-ranked Herbert Hoover (4-2) on Friday. The kickoff is set for 7:30 pm.

The Wayne Pioneers (3-5) are 23rd this week after losing a heart breaker to Chapmanville. The Pioneers look to get back on track by hosting Sissonville (1-6) this Friday. The opening kick is scheduled for 7pm.

The Westside Renegades (2-5) are in the 29th spot after falling at falling at 7th-ranked Nicholas County, 62-13. The Renegades will now travel to Naugatuck to face the 15th-ranked team in Class A – Tug Valley (5-2). The opening kick is set for 7:30 pm at Bob Brewer Stadium in Naugatuck.

The top 16 teams in each class at season’s end qualify for the WVSSAC State Football Championship Tournament.
